Float hex representation

WebAug 2, 2024 · There are at least five internal formats for floating-point numbers that are representable in hardware targeted by the MSVC compiler. The compiler only uses two … WebAug 9, 2016 · This is a bit tricky in python, because aren't looking to convert the floating-point value to a (hex) integer. Instead, you're trying to interpret the IEEE 754 binary …

How do you represent a floating point number in hexadecimal?

WebThe assembler assembles a floating-point constant into its binary representation as follows: The specified number, multiplied by any exponents, is converted to the required … WebJun 14, 2006 · floats' internal representation in Python is 8 bytes (equivalent to a C "double"). However, you can import struct and use struct.pack('f',x) to get a 4-byte ("single precision") approximation of x's 8-byte value, returned as a string of 4 bytes; you may force little-endian by using as grange new york https://rollingidols.com

Representation of hexadecimal floating point - IBM

http://evanw.github.io/float-toy/ WebRepresentation of hexadecimal floating point HLASM Language Reference SC26-4940-06 The assembler assembles a floating-point constant into its binary representation as … WebAug 2, 2024 · The IEEE-754 standard describes floating-point formats, a way to represent real numbers in hardware. There are at least five internal formats for floating-point numbers that are representable in hardware targeted by the … grange ns carlow

IEEE Standard for Floating-Point, ASCII, and Hexadecimal

Category:IEEE Standard 754 Floating Point Numbers

Tags:Float hex representation

Float hex representation

IEEE-754 Floating-Point Conversion from 32-bit Hexadecimal to …

WebAug 4, 2024 · Below is the implementation of the above approach: Program 1: Convert a real value to its floating point representation C++ C Python3 #include using namespace std; void printBinary (int n, int i) { int k; for (k = i - 1; k >= 0; k--) { if ( (n >> k) & 1) cout << "1"; else cout << "0"; } } typedef union { float f; struct { Web1 day ago · The Python interpreter has a number of functions and types built into it that are always available. They are listed here in alphabetical order. abs(x) ¶ Return the absolute value of a number. The argument may be an integer, a floating point number, or an object implementing __abs__ () .

Float hex representation

Did you know?

WebJan 20, 2024 · In computing, a floating-point number is a data format used to store fractional numbers in a digital machine. A floating-point number is represented by a series of bits …

Web1 day ago · I was reading Robert Nystrom's Crafting Interpreters section on NaN boxing/tagging, and was curious about his oblique mention of not wanting to collide with a special NaN value which he calls "Intel’s 'QNaN Floating-Point Indefinite'" (a hazard when storing data in specially crafted NaN payloads).. From this reference sheet provided by … WebOct 12, 2024 · Convert a hexadecimal string to a float. Convert a byte array to a hexadecimal string. Examples This example outputs the hexadecimal value of each character in a string. First it parses the string to an array of characters. Then it calls ToInt32 (Char) on each character to obtain its numeric value.

Web1 day ago · float.hex() ¶ Return a representation of a floating-point number as a hexadecimal string. For finite floating-point numbers, this representation will always include a leading 0x and a trailing p and exponent. classmethod float.fromhex(s) ¶ Class method to return the float represented by a hexadecimal string s. WebIn comparison to IEEE 754 floating point, the HFP format has a longer significand, and a shorter exponent. All HFP formats have 7 bits of exponent with a bias of 64. The normalized range of representable numbers is from 16 −65 to 16 63 (approx. 5.39761 × 10 −79 to 7.237005 × 10 75 ).

WebFloating point notation is introduced to store any number in a predefined format. In our case we focus only on 32 bit. The value of a IEEE-754 number is computed as: sign 2exponent mantissa. The sign is stored in bit 32. The exponent can be computed from bits 24-31 by subtracting 127. The mantissa (also known as significand or fraction) is ...

WebThe bfloat16 format, being a truncated IEEE 754 single-precision32-bit float, allows for fast conversionto and from an IEEE 754 single-precision 32-bit float; in conversion to the bfloat16 format, the exponent bits are preserved while the significand field can be reduced by truncation (thus corresponding to round toward 0), ignoring the … grange nursery farnboroughWeb2 days ago · The float.hex () method expresses a float in hexadecimal (base 16), again giving the exact value stored by your computer: >>> >>> x.hex() '0x1.921f9f01b866ep+1' … grange nursery schoolWebA floating-point variable can represent a wider range of numbers than a fixed-point variable of the same bit width at the cost of precision. A signed 32-bit integer variable has a maximum value of 2 31 − 1 = 2,147,483,647, whereas an IEEE 754 32-bit base-2 floating-point variable has a maximum value of (2 − 2 −23) × 2 127 ≈ 3.4028235 × 10 38. grange nursery ealingWebDec 14, 2024 · How do you represent a floating point number in hexadecimal? C99 supports floating-point numbers that can be written in hexadecimal format. In hexadecimal format the exponent is a decimal number that indicates the power of two by which the significant part is multiplied. Therefore 0x1. fp3 = 1.9375 * 8 = 1.55e1. chinesische platte und philippinische platteWebFloating Point to Hex Converter. Check out the new Windows and Windows Phone apps! Here are the Python files that are needed to make your own: floattohexmodule.c - the C … chinesische philosophie und religionWebQuestion: After putting the number in floating point representation, place the exponent portion intor1. Write the line of code in Assembly language that would put the hexadecimal representationof that number into r1. After putting the number in floating point representation, place the exponent portion into. r1. grange nursery pontefractWebFloating-point representation IEEE numbers are stored using a kind of scientific notation. ± mantissa *2 exponent We can represent floating -point numbers with three binary fields: … grange nursing home coffs harbour